Overview

Our FTSE 250 client is hiring a Systems Project Manager to lead the implementation of a new system.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end system implementation, from design through to go-live and optimisation
  • Translate business requirements into effective processes and system solutions
  • Oversee testing, data migration and deployment
  • Document processes, controls and user guidance
  • Act as the link between Finance, IT and vendors, driving continuous improvement

Candidate Profile

  • ACA/ACCA/CIMA qualified
  • Proven experience delivering finance systems implementations
  • Strong understanding of finance processes and controls
  • Confident communicator, able to influence stakeholders
  • Hands-on and comfortable in a change environment
